Juvenile Treated for possible Drowning at YMCA

On February 26th, 2026, at 4:31 p.m., the Clermont County Communications Center received a 911 call from a female staff member at the YMCA, located in the 2000 block of James E. Sauls Sr. Drive in Williamsburg Township, Clermont County, reporting a possible drowning involving a 17-year-old male in the pool.


Deputies with the Clermont County Sheriff’s Office were dispatched and arrived on scene at approximately 4:35 p.m. Williamsburg Township Fire & EMS was also dispatched and arrived shortly thereafter at approximately 4:36 p.m.


On duty lifeguards were on scene and immediately pulled the victim from the water and began CPR. Upon arrival, Williamsburg Township EMS relieved staff and continued patient care.


Due to the seriousness of the incident, although a pulse was restored, AirCare was requested at approximately 4:40 p.m. by Williamsburg Township Fire & EMS. The patient was transported by air to University of Cincinnati Medical Center for further treatment at 5:29 p.m.


The victim is currently listed in stable condition.


Detectives and the Crime Scene Unit from the Clermont County Sheriff’s Office Investigative Unit responded to the scene and continue to investigate the circumstances surrounding the incident.


At this time, foul play is not suspected.
